Creating Gambling Limits


Establishing clear betting limits is important for having control over your bankroll while gambling on casino games. Prior to you start gambling, decide on the maximum amount of money you are willing to spend during a session. This budget should be an amount that you can bear to lose without impacting your financial well-being, allowing that you can savor the experience without excessive stress.


Once you have established your budget, break it down into smaller betting limits for each game you intend to play. For instance, if you have a budget of 200 dollars and intend to engage in slots, roulette, and blackjack, allocate certain amounts for each game. This method minimizes the temptation to spend more than you had originally planned and allows you to enjoy each game while systematically managing your funds.
